>> Perhaps you turned on the 'tmux-MacOSX-pasteboard' program?
>> 
>> 
>> I also had this issue, after I upgraded from Snow Leopard(10.6) to Mountain 
>> Lion(10.8). 
>> Like you, I had nearly one panic a day. The kernel panic log showed: 
>> "negative open count"
>> Upgrading/Compiling MacVim did not solve the issue. I was using 7.3 before 
>> upgrading the OS.
>> 
>> I recalled that I was using the 'tmux-MacOSX-pasteboard' program before 
>> upgrading to Mountain Lion. 
>> 
>> https://github.com/ChrisJohnsen/tmux-MacOSX-pasteboard
>> 
>> I wasn't sure it had anything to do with it, but at least it was something 
>> that was interacting with the lower level and Vim, so I thought it was worth 
>> a try.
>> I decided to turn off that program, and see how well it goes along.
>> That was early November... and I haven't met any crashes since then.
